From there, the VA will find the diagnostic code that … Web30 mrt. 2024 · 03/30/2024. There are three categories of VA sleep disorder ratings. You can have an insomnia VA rating, narcolepsy VA rating and a sleep apnea VA rating. By accurately distinguishing the symptoms for all three sleep disorders, you can obtain an individual disability rating for each one. Insomnia is the most common sleep disorder.

The lack of sleep occurs as a result of military service or a situation from … finra focus filing dates 2022Web7 feb. 2024 · There is no specific VA rating for acid reflux or GERD. It is commonly rated under “Diagnostic Code 7346, Hernia, Hiatal” under § 4.114 Schedule of ratings – digestive system. A hiatal hernia is a common cause of GERD.
